### Step 4: Gate the canary

Once Driftgate shows the canary slice at 5%, hold there until error rate and p95 latency stay green for 30 minutes. Don't bump to 25% early, even if dashboards look calm — the gating rules exist for a reason. Promotion requires a signed approval manifest, so sign it with the key below.

rollout seal: bky19_M1Zvn1YQwEBTy4XxP3H

## Alert: StatRelay Sidecar Flush Lag

This alert fires when the StatRelay metrics-aggregation sidecar falls more than 120 seconds behind on flushing buffered samples to the Coalmine backend. Plugin-emitted counters are buffered in-process, so sustained lag usually means a plugin is emitting unbounded label cardinality or blocking the flush thread. Check your plugin's metric registration against the published cardinality limits before escalating. If the lag persists after your plugin is ruled out, contact the telemetry team.

escalation mailbox, bagug-fahof: novdor.wendor.jormir@norvalabs.example

**Ticket: GPUtrace 1.8 release blocked — signature verification failed**

The staging pipeline rejected the GPUtrace profiler package because its signature doesn't match the current trust anchor. Root cause: the artifact was signed with the retired Q2 key after last month's rotation. The memory-capture binaries themselves are fine; only re-signing is needed. Please re-sign the bundle and republish. For reference, the active release signing key is below.

release key, fajef-kajeg: bky19_LdLu6Ne6FLi8he2c24d